Human Anti-HIV-1 Env Recombinant Antibody (clone CH239) (CAT#: MRO-2779CQ)

Recombinant human antibody to Env. CH239 can neutralize HIV-1 isolates.

Figure 5 CH235 Antibody Lineage Autoreactivity and Polyreactivity.

Figure 5 CH235 Antibody Lineage Autoreactivity and Polyreactivity.

Measurement of polyreactivity against 9,400 human antigens using ProtoArray 5 microchip: CH235 lineage mAbs binding (x axis) was compared to nonpolyreactive control mAb 151K (y axis). Polyreactivity is defined as 1 log stronger binding than 151k mAb to more than 90% of the test proteins. High affinity binding was measured as a>2 log increase in binding (dotted line).

Bonsignori, M., Zhou, T., Sheng, Z., Chen, L., Gao, F., Joyce, M. G., ... & Alam, S. M. (2016). Maturation pathway from germline to broad HIV-1 neutralizer of a CD4-mimic antibody. Cell, 165(2), 449-463.
